Abstract: degenerative disease is a disease in which the function or structure of the affected tissues or organs will increasingly deteriorate over time, whether due to normal bodily wear or lifestyle choices such as exercise or eating habits. This study was conducted in Ribat hospital and Omdurman hospital in Khartoum state. Data were obtained collected from May 2014 through June 2014. Data were collected by computed radiography device and conventional device. The main aim of this study was done to determine the best modality for diagnostic degenerative disease. A total of 50 samples were collected by CR and same sample by conventional radiographic films/screen system ( 23 male and 27 female ), the reserch showed that both imging modalities can be used to detect joint space. Further more computed radiography is better than conventional rdiography in case of assessment of subarticular and subcondoral changes.
